In January 2017, EIGE took over the database on women and men in decision-making (WMID), which was previously managed by the European Commission. The WMID entry point had been launched in 2003 to monitor the numbers of men and women in key decision-making positions to provide reliable statistics that can be used to draw comparisons between European countries and analyse...
The European Institute for Gender Equality (EIGE) monitors the gender balance among key decision-makers biannually for the largest listed companies in the EU and annually for central banks and European financial institutions. Regular monitoring is crucial for assessing progress in achieving new legislative targets. This brief provides an overview of the 2024 status and current trends related to gender balance...
